IT also delivers Information Technology applications, infrastructure, and project services in a cost efficient manner to Corning worldwide.Role PurposeThe Manufacturing Execution System (MES) Solution Architect role will be responsible for working with business leaders and users as well as IT resources to define, develop, implement, and support standardized Siemens Opcenter Execution (formerly known as Camstar) solutions across a global environment.Key ResponsibilitiesStrategic view and understanding of Siemens Opcenter Execution to lead design and development efforts across Corning.Design, implement, and support manufacturing solutions in accordance to standard Corning IT practicesStrong technical understanding and hands-on experience with Siemens Opcenter Execution modeling and development tools including Designer and Portal.Engage with internal/external customers to analyze requirements from a business and systems perspective by interpreting business goals and objectives and translating them into technical solutions. Strong understanding of ERP, MES, shop floor controls and how they integrate to provide a complete solution to the plant.Ensure that MES work is completed on schedule and that impacts to manufacturing systems are thoroughly documented and communicated by serving as the MES lead on global projects.Create specifications for developers to use as direction for development.Experiences/Education - RequiredBS/MS in Computer Science /Systems Management/IT Related fieldStrong leadership and project management skillsIn-depth knowledge of industry best practices in application development5+ years’ experience using programming languages such as .NET, C#Experience working with IT systems in a 24/7 manufacturing environmentIn-depth knowledge of source code management systemsIn-depth knowledge of relational databasesUnderstanding of Software Development Life Cycle, Test Driven Development, Continuous Integration and Continuous Delivery.Experience developing in Siemens Opcenter Execution Designer and Portal.Experience working in a Scrum/Agile team.Strong communication, presentation, organizational, facilitation and negotiation skills (including ability to “translate” between business and technology needs).Proven track record of implementing IT solutions that make meet business demands and are technically sound.Ability to continuously prioritize and multitask efficiently.Ability to influence decisions with critical thinking based upon experience and graspof the strategic intent of the project.Experience with Angular developmentThis position does not support immigration sponsorship.The range for this position is$103,426.00-$142,211.00assuming full time status.
